278 // When a lock is destroyed, in some semantics(like PthreadSemantics) we are not
279 // sure if the destroy call has succeeded or failed, and the lock enters one of
280 // the 'possibly destroyed' state. There is a short time frame for the
281 // programmer to check the return value to see if the lock was successfully
282 // destroyed. Before we model the next operation over that lock, we call this
283 // function to see if the return value was checked by now and set the lock state
284 // - either to destroyed state or back to its previous state.
285
286 // In PthreadSemantics, pthread_mutex_destroy() returns zero if the lock is
287 // successfully destroyed and it returns a non-zero value otherwise.
resolvePossiblyDestroyedMutex(ProgramStateRef state,const MemRegion * lockR,const SymbolRef * sym) const288 ProgramStateRef PthreadLockChecker::resolvePossiblyDestroyedMutex(
289 ProgramStateRef state, const MemRegion *lockR, const SymbolRef *sym) const {
290 const LockState *lstate = state->get<LockMap>(lockR);
291 // Existence in DestroyRetVal ensures existence in LockMap.
292 // Existence in Destroyed also ensures that the lock state for lockR is either
293 // UntouchedAndPossiblyDestroyed or UnlockedAndPossiblyDestroyed.
294 assert(lstate->isUntouchedAndPossiblyDestroyed() ||
295 lstate->isUnlockedAndPossiblyDestroyed());
296
297 ConstraintManager &CMgr = state->getConstraintManager();
298 ConditionTruthVal retZero = CMgr.isNull(state, *sym);
299 if (retZero.isConstrainedFalse()) {
300 if (lstate->isUntouchedAndPossiblyDestroyed())
301 state = state->remove<LockMap>(lockR);
302 else if (lstate->isUnlockedAndPossiblyDestroyed())
303 state = state->set<LockMap>(lockR, LockState::getUnlocked());
304 } else
305 state = state->set<LockMap>(lockR, LockState::getDestroyed());
306
307 // Removing the map entry (lockR, sym) from DestroyRetVal as the lock state is
308 // now resolved.
309 state = state->remove<DestroyRetVal>(lockR);
310 return state;
311 }

AcquireLockAux(const CallEvent & Call,CheckerContext & C,const Expr * MtxExpr,SVal MtxVal,bool IsTryLock,enum LockingSemantics Semantics,CheckerKind CheckKind) const395 void PthreadLockChecker::AcquireLockAux(const CallEvent &Call,
396 CheckerContext &C, const Expr *MtxExpr,
397 SVal MtxVal, bool IsTryLock,
398 enum LockingSemantics Semantics,
399 CheckerKind CheckKind) const {
400 if (!ChecksEnabled[CheckKind])
401 return;
402
403 const MemRegion *lockR = MtxVal.getAsRegion();
404 if (!lockR)
405 return;
406
407 ProgramStateRef state = C.getState();
408 const SymbolRef *sym = state->get<DestroyRetVal>(lockR);
409 if (sym)
410 state = resolvePossiblyDestroyedMutex(state, lockR, sym);
411
412 if (const LockState *LState = state->get<LockMap>(lockR)) {
413 if (LState->isLocked()) {
414 reportBug(C, BT_doublelock, MtxExpr, CheckKind,
415 "This lock has already been acquired");
416 return;
417 } else if (LState->isDestroyed()) {
418 reportBug(C, BT_destroylock, MtxExpr, CheckKind,
419 "This lock has already been destroyed");
420 return;
421 }
422 }
423
424 ProgramStateRef lockSucc = state;
425 if (IsTryLock) {
426 // Bifurcate the state, and allow a mode where the lock acquisition fails.
427 SVal RetVal = Call.getReturnValue();
428 if (auto DefinedRetVal = RetVal.getAs<DefinedSVal>()) {
429 ProgramStateRef lockFail;
430 switch (Semantics) {
431 case PthreadSemantics:
432 std::tie(lockFail, lockSucc) = state->assume(*DefinedRetVal);
433 break;
434 case XNUSemantics:
435 std::tie(lockSucc, lockFail) = state->assume(*DefinedRetVal);
436 break;
437 default:
438 llvm_unreachable("Unknown tryLock locking semantics");
439 }
440 assert(lockFail && lockSucc);
441 C.addTransition(lockFail);
442 }
443 // We might want to handle the case when the mutex lock function was inlined
444 // and returned an Unknown or Undefined value.
445 } else if (Semantics == PthreadSemantics) {
446 // Assume that the return value was 0.
447 SVal RetVal = Call.getReturnValue();
448 if (auto DefinedRetVal = RetVal.getAs<DefinedSVal>()) {
449 // FIXME: If the lock function was inlined and returned true,
450 // we need to behave sanely - at least generate sink.
451 lockSucc = state->assume(*DefinedRetVal, false);
452 assert(lockSucc);
453 }
454 // We might want to handle the case when the mutex lock function was inlined
455 // and returned an Unknown or Undefined value.
456 } else {
457 // XNU locking semantics return void on non-try locks
458 assert((Semantics == XNUSemantics) && "Unknown locking semantics");
459 lockSucc = state;
460 }
461
462 // Record that the lock was acquired.
463 lockSucc = lockSucc->add<LockSet>(lockR);
464 lockSucc = lockSucc->set<LockMap>(lockR, LockState::getLocked());
465 C.addTransition(lockSucc);
466 }

ReleaseLockAux(const CallEvent & Call,CheckerContext & C,const Expr * MtxExpr,SVal MtxVal,CheckerKind CheckKind) const474 void PthreadLockChecker::ReleaseLockAux(const CallEvent &Call,
475 CheckerContext &C, const Expr *MtxExpr,
476 SVal MtxVal,
477 CheckerKind CheckKind) const {
478 if (!ChecksEnabled[CheckKind])
479 return;
480
481 const MemRegion *lockR = MtxVal.getAsRegion();
482 if (!lockR)
483 return;
484
485 ProgramStateRef state = C.getState();
486 const SymbolRef *sym = state->get<DestroyRetVal>(lockR);
487 if (sym)
488 state = resolvePossiblyDestroyedMutex(state, lockR, sym);
489
490 if (const LockState *LState = state->get<LockMap>(lockR)) {
491 if (LState->isUnlocked()) {
492 reportBug(C, BT_doubleunlock, MtxExpr, CheckKind,
493 "This lock has already been unlocked");
494 return;
495 } else if (LState->isDestroyed()) {
496 reportBug(C, BT_destroylock, MtxExpr, CheckKind,
497 "This lock has already been destroyed");
498 return;
499 }
500 }
501
502 LockSetTy LS = state->get<LockSet>();
503
504 if (!LS.isEmpty()) {
505 const MemRegion *firstLockR = LS.getHead();
506 if (firstLockR != lockR) {
507 reportBug(C, BT_lor, MtxExpr, CheckKind,
508 "This was not the most recently acquired lock. Possible lock "
509 "order reversal");
510 return;
511 }
512 // Record that the lock was released.
513 state = state->set<LockSet>(LS.getTail());
514 }
515
516 state = state->set<LockMap>(lockR, LockState::getUnlocked());
517 C.addTransition(state);
518 }
